A visit to Fort Collins is just not complete without experiencing this lovingly restored historic grain mill that’s become a hub for food and community. Home to a market, bakery, restaurants, teaching kitchen, unique event spaces and great patios, it’s become a gathering place for dining, shopping, learning, celebrating and enjoying a great slice of homemade pie. In the Café, you’ll find comfort food made from scratch including chicken pot pie, burgers, meatloaf and salads along with homestyle breakfast served all day and fresh-baked pies, breads and pastries. The Cache at Ginger and Baker offers a modern Colorado steakhouse experience with hand-cut steaks and chops, seafood, craft cocktails and a wine list that annually wins Wine Spectator Award of Excellence. Dining is also on the newly remodeled glass-enclosed Rooftop Patio. Join us in the Teaching Kitchen for classes on cooking, baking, whiskey and wine appreciation and more. Stop in the Market and Coffeeshop and browse housemade goods, seasonal décor and gift ideas, then grab a great cup of locally roasted coffee and a scratch-made pastry. Ginger and Baker is proud to partner with local farmers, ranchers, food artisans and craftspeople to showcase the innovative, hardworking spirit that makes Northern Colorado so unique. Editorial Review
Ginger and Baker occupies a red-brick historic mill on the river and feels less like a restaurant and more like a small-town town square. Multiple rooms let it wear different moods: a bustling café and bakery for morning coffee and pie, a roomy American dining space that leans farm-to-fork, and a rooftop with a fireplace and big-screen TVs that turns evenings into casual cocktail hours. The market counter sells whole pies you can take home; the teaching kitchen and event rooms make it the go-to for rehearsal dinners and neighborhood celebrations. Locals drop in for flaky biscuits, a turkey pesto sandwich or a coconut chai; visitors come for the rooftop scene and the novelty of pie-in-a-glass. Dog owners stake out patio tables. It’s the kind of place that still stitches community together — farmers’ market sensibility meets elevated comfort food — equal parts hometown anchor and clever, wedding-friendly event space. Expect lively service, reserved weekend nights, and desserts that steal the show.
